
Resources by Category
Shop by Grade
Make Your Free Time Yours Again
As a teacher, you never really stop thinking about your students, which means you’re always thinking about how you can incorporate new ideas into your teaching. It also means you’re always working, and you never really have a chance to enjoy free time outside of the classroom.
Our educational resources — designed by teachers, for teachers — don’t just provide an amazing framework for your next lesson, but also save you a ton of time, so you can make your free time yours again.
MEET JULIE
Hello and thank you for visiting MagiCore!
I wanted to be a teacher since I can remember.
I taught second through fifth grade in Florida and Rhode Island for ten years. When Common Core was first introduced, my colleagues and I struggled to find standards based resources. I started MagiCore as a way to share the resources I created to help my own students succeed.
Over the past decade, more than 100,000 teachers have trusted our growing library of resources in their classrooms. Our mission is to help teachers like you connect with their students and make a lasting impact.
Featured Resources
Latest From the Blog
5 Tips to Encourage Your Students During Standardized Testing
It’s that time of year again – when the state testing period comes around and students’ nerves start to fray. If you’re looking for ways to support your students during
Why and How to Scaffold Reading with Complex Texts
The Science of Reading has become the latest hot topic in education. However, The Science of Reading is a broad term that refers to scientifically based research about teaching reading.
Understanding the Meaning of the Equal Sign
Who knew that in all of those years of my school career, the equal sign didn’t just mean that the answer goes on the other side of the equation? That’s
Adding Three Numbers up to 20 in a Word Problem
I love teaching adding 3 numbers in word problems. Yes, you may be furrowing your brows right now. I know word problems have somewhat of a stigma of making students
Ideas for Teaching 10 more 10 Less in First Grade
Can we take a second to talk about skills that we were under an assumption would be easy for students to grasp but in reality it’s just a smidge more
Strategies for Introducing Word Problems
It’s a couple of months into your school year and you’ve probably made your way into teaching math word problems by now. Once the foundation for computational skills has been
Seven Tips for an Easy and Fun Classroom Holiday Party
The holidays are a wonderful time to celebrate with your students! But if you’re anything like me, the thought of planning a party for 20+ kiddos can be daunting. Never
Ways to Teach Greater Than and Less Than
Ok, you’ve made it over the hump of teaching basic place value, so now it’s time to build onto that skill. Number comparison (greater than and less than) is a